Overview
Assists in engineering projects by performing the following duties.
Job Responsibilities
- Demonstrates practical experience designing HVAC and mechanical systems, including load calculations, equipment selection and sizing, ductwork and piping design, controls coordination, and application of applicable mechanical, energy, and ventilation codes.
- Performs increasingly complex engineering assignments using standard engineering principles, techniques, procedures, and independent judgment. Assignments include more variables and require greater responsibility than those assigned to Level I and II Engineers.
- Designs routine projects and portions of more complex, non-routine projects under the direction of a Project Engineer or other senior technical staff.
- Prepares reports, specifications, plans, construction schedules, cost estimates, and permit documents under the direction of the Group leader or other senior-level engineer.
- Produces routine final drawings and models using the latest version of Revit and, as required, AutoCAD.
- Researches discipline-related code requirements and presents interpretations and recommendations.
- Visits construction sites and attends site meetings to review, monitor, and report construction progress. Performs construction administration duties, including shop drawing reviews, responses to RFIs, preparation of supplemental instructions or proposal requests, and status reports.
- Must be proficient in the use of:
• Microsoft Windows, Excel and Word
• Revit
• AutoCAD
• Trane Trace Pus 3D or Trane Trace Load 700
• Trane Trace Energy Modeling Software or EQUEST
• Florida Energy Code – FLACOM
• Miscellaneous mechanical system and product selection and sizing software - Instructs drafters and designers to produce designs into coordinated working drawings.
- Checks one’s own work and reviews work prepared by drafters and designers for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with project requirements.
- Coordinates mechanical drawings and specifications with all applicable project disciplines.
- Assists in preparing design budgets, marketing proposals and project cost estimates.
- Assists with client communication and coordination pertaining to assigned projects.
- Promotes communication, cooperation and quality among team members.
- Represents the firm in a professional manner.
- Performs energy analyses (energy modeling) for a wide range of projects, especially for all BRPH LEED projects.
Education and/or Experience
- Minimum of bachelor’s degree in engineering from an accredited four-year college or university, and
- Minimum of two years experience as a mechanical engineer
Certificates, Licenses, Registrations
- Possess a certificate of Engineering Intern
